Spackman Media Group Artist Son Suk-Ku’s K-Drama, MY LIBERATION NOTES, Claims #1 Spot In Korean TV Drama Rankings

  • MY LIBERATION NOTES, the Korean drama series starring Spackman Media Group artist Son Suk-ku, took the top spot in TV drama rankings in Korea, according to Good Data TV Popularity Research
  • Represented by SBD Entertainment,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Spackman Media Group, Son Suk-ku was also ranked number one in actor popularity on the back of MY LIBERATION NOTES, based on Good Data TV Popularity Research
  • Son Suk-ku stars along with Ma Dong-seok (Don Lee) in upcoming film THE ROUNDUP, a sequel film to the 2017 box office hit THE OUTLAWS, which is expected to be released on May 18
